Understanding Non-Surgical Hair Restoration

Non-surgical hair restoration refers to treatments that support hair growth, scalp health, and follicular function without surgical transplantation. These solutions are ideal for:

  • Early to moderate hair thinning

  • Androgenetic alopecia (male and female pattern hair loss)

  • Diffuse shedding and reduced density

  • Patients unwilling or unsuitable for surgery

Traditional non-surgical methods include topical solutions, oral medications, PRP injections, and microneedling. While some of these approaches can be effective, they often come with limitations such as inconsistent absorption, discomfort, downtime, or patient reluctance.

Modern energy-based and transdermal delivery systems—such as Alma TED and InFuze™—aim to overcome these challenges by enhancing scalp permeability and improving the delivery of clinician-selected actives.


What Is the Alma TED Machine?

Alma TED (TransEpidermal Delivery) is a non-invasive hair restoration device developed by Alma Lasers. It uses ultrasound-based technology to help deliver topical hair growth solutions into the scalp without needles.

Core Concept of Alma TED

The Alma TED system is built around ultrasound energy designed to temporarily increase scalp permeability. This allows specific proprietary solutions to penetrate beyond the surface of the scalp more effectively than standard topical application.

The treatment is marketed as:

  • Needle-free

  • Painless

  • No downtime

  • Suitable for both men and women

Introducing InFuze™ Non-Surgical Hair Restoration

InFuze™ is an advanced, non-surgical hair restoration system developed to overcome the limitations of conventional topical and ultrasound-only treatments. It is a needle-free, painless Permeation & Pulsed Delivery System engineered specifically for scalp revitalization and follicular stimulation.

Unlike Alma TED, InFuze™ does not rely on passive absorption alone. Instead, it uses a dual-technology approach that actively transports clinician-selected bioactive compounds toward the dermal and follicular layers with precision and consistency.

Core Technology Behind InFuze™

  • 40 kHz Ultrasonic Permeation: Temporarily disrupts the scalp’s barrier to enhance permeability

  • Pulsed High-Velocity Transdermal Delivery: Propels micro-droplets of active solutions at high speed toward follicular targets

  • Sealed-Contact Precision Applicator: Ensures uniform contact, controlled dosing, and minimal run-off

This technology allows InFuze™ to achieve deeper, more uniform, and more reproducible delivery than ultrasound-only systems.
